@@ -101,7 +101,7 @@ |
||
| 101 | 101 | /** |
| 102 | 102 | * Get the services provided by the provider. |
| 103 | 103 | * |
| 104 | - * @return array |
|
| 104 | + * @return string[] |
|
| 105 | 105 | */ |
| 106 | 106 | public function provides() |
| 107 | 107 | { |
@@ -2,12 +2,12 @@ |
||
| 2 | 2 | |
| 3 | 3 | namespace Telegram\Bot\Laravel; |
| 4 | 4 | |
| 5 | -use Telegram\Bot\Api; |
|
| 6 | -use Telegram\Bot\BotsManager; |
|
| 7 | -use Illuminate\Support\ServiceProvider; |
|
| 8 | 5 | use Illuminate\Contracts\Foundation\Application; |
| 9 | -use Laravel\Lumen\Application as LumenApplication; |
|
| 10 | 6 | use Illuminate\Foundation\Application as LaravelApplication; |
| 7 | +use Illuminate\Support\ServiceProvider; |
|
| 8 | +use Laravel\Lumen\Application as LumenApplication; |
|
| 9 | +use Telegram\Bot\Api; |
|
| 10 | +use Telegram\Bot\BotsManager; |
|
| 11 | 11 | |
| 12 | 12 | /** |
| 13 | 13 | * Class TelegramServiceProvider. |
@@ -8,13 +8,13 @@ |
||
| 8 | 8 | use Telegram\Bot\FileUpload\InputFile; |
| 9 | 9 | use Telegram\Bot\HttpClients\GuzzleHttpClient; |
| 10 | 10 | use Telegram\Bot\HttpClients\HttpClientInterface; |
| 11 | +use Telegram\Bot\Keyboard\Keyboard; |
|
| 11 | 12 | use Telegram\Bot\Objects\File; |
| 12 | 13 | use Telegram\Bot\Objects\Message; |
| 13 | 14 | use Telegram\Bot\Objects\UnknownObject; |
| 14 | 15 | use Telegram\Bot\Objects\Update; |
| 15 | 16 | use Telegram\Bot\Objects\User; |
| 16 | 17 | use Telegram\Bot\Objects\UserProfilePhotos; |
| 17 | -use Telegram\Bot\Keyboard\Keyboard; |
|
| 18 | 18 | |
| 19 | 19 | /** |
| 20 | 20 | * Class Api. |
@@ -282,7 +282,7 @@ discard block |
||
| 282 | 282 | * @var string $params ['url'] |
| 283 | 283 | * @var int $params ['cache_time'] |
| 284 | 284 | * |
| 285 | - * @return Message |
|
| 285 | + * @return boolean |
|
| 286 | 286 | */ |
| 287 | 287 | |
| 288 | 288 | public function answerCallbackQuery(array $params) |
@@ -1279,7 +1279,7 @@ discard block |
||
| 1279 | 1279 | * @var bool $params ['one_time_keyboard'] |
| 1280 | 1280 | * @var bool $params ['selective'] |
| 1281 | 1281 | * |
| 1282 | - * @return string |
|
| 1282 | + * @return Keyboard |
|
| 1283 | 1283 | */ |
| 1284 | 1284 | public function replyKeyboardMarkup(array $params) |
| 1285 | 1285 | { |
@@ -1306,7 +1306,7 @@ discard block |
||
| 1306 | 1306 | * @var bool $params ['hide_keyboard'] |
| 1307 | 1307 | * @var bool $params ['selective'] |
| 1308 | 1308 | * |
| 1309 | - * @return string |
|
| 1309 | + * @return Keyboard |
|
| 1310 | 1310 | */ |
| 1311 | 1311 | public static function replyKeyboardHide(array $params = []) |
| 1312 | 1312 | { |
@@ -1493,7 +1493,7 @@ discard block |
||
| 1493 | 1493 | * Used primarily for file uploads. |
| 1494 | 1494 | * |
| 1495 | 1495 | * @param string $endpoint |
| 1496 | - * @param array $params |
|
| 1496 | + * @param string $params |
|
| 1497 | 1497 | * |
| 1498 | 1498 | * @throws TelegramSDKException |
| 1499 | 1499 | * |
@@ -157,7 +157,7 @@ discard block |
||
| 157 | 157 | * |
| 158 | 158 | * @param $line |
| 159 | 159 | * @param $replace |
| 160 | - * @param $delimiter |
|
| 160 | + * @param string $delimiter |
|
| 161 | 161 | * |
| 162 | 162 | * @return mixed |
| 163 | 163 | */ |
@@ -175,7 +175,7 @@ discard block |
||
| 175 | 175 | * |
| 176 | 176 | * @param $line |
| 177 | 177 | * @param $replace |
| 178 | - * @param $delimiter |
|
| 178 | + * @param string $delimiter |
|
| 179 | 179 | * |
| 180 | 180 | * @return mixed |
| 181 | 181 | */ |
@@ -13,7 +13,7 @@ |
||
| 13 | 13 | private $eventEmitter; |
| 14 | 14 | |
| 15 | 15 | /** |
| 16 | - * @param EventInterface|string $event |
|
| 16 | + * @param UpdateWasReceived $event |
|
| 17 | 17 | * @throws \InvalidArgumentException |
| 18 | 18 | * @return bool true if emitted, false otherwise |
| 19 | 19 | */ |